- Timestamp:
- 06/14/12 13:07:35 (13 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
branches/hpc33/src/STFitter.cpp
r2394 r2569 376 376 377 377 // Fit 378 Vector<Float> sigma(x_.nelements());379 sigma = 1.0;378 // Vector<Float> sigma(x_.nelements()); 379 // sigma = 1.0; 380 380 381 381 parameters_.resize(); 382 parameters_ = fitter.fit(x_, y_, sigma, &m_); 382 // parameters_ = fitter.fit(x_, y_, sigma, &m_); 383 parameters_ = fitter.fit(x_, y_, &m_); 383 384 if ( !fitter.converged() ) { 384 385 return false; … … 398 399 // use fitter.residual(model=True) to get the model 399 400 thefit_.resize(x_.nelements()); 400 fitter.residual(thefit_,x_,True); 401 // model = data - residual 402 // fitter.residual(thefit_,x_,True); 403 thefit_ = y_ - residual_ ; 401 404 return true; 402 405 } … … 417 420 418 421 // Fit 419 Vector<Float> sigma(x_.nelements());420 sigma = 1.0;422 // Vector<Float> sigma(x_.nelements()); 423 // sigma = 1.0; 421 424 422 425 parameters_.resize(); 423 parameters_ = fitter.fit(x_, y_, sigma, &m_); 426 // parameters_ = fitter.fit(x_, y_, sigma, &m_); 427 parameters_ = fitter.fit(x_, y_, &m_); 424 428 std::vector<float> ps; 425 429 parameters_.tovector(ps); … … 436 440 // use fitter.residual(model=True) to get the model 437 441 thefit_.resize(x_.nelements()); 438 fitter.residual(thefit_,x_,True); 442 // model = data - residual 443 // fitter.residual(thefit_,x_,True); 444 thefit_ = y_ - residual_ ; 439 445 return true; 440 446 }
Note:
See TracChangeset
for help on using the changeset viewer.